Reducing energy demand: a path to sustainability

As the world grapples with the challenges of climate change and environmental degradation, reducing energy demand has emerged as a critical component in the pursuit of sustainability. By curbing our appetite for energy, we not only contribute to a healthier planet but also pave the way for a more resilient and efficient future. Here are some practical steps we can take to reduce energy demand in our homes and communities.

Embrace Energy-Efficient Technologies - the adoption of energy-efficient technologies is a cornerstone in the quest to reduce energy demand. From LED lighting to smart appliances and HVAC systems, investing in advanced, energy-saving solutions can significantly cut down on consumption. Consider upgrading to appliances with high Energy Star ratings and implementing smart home devices that optimise energy usage.

Implement Smart Building Design - Architects and builders play a crucial role in reducing energy demand through thoughtful building design. Incorporating passive solar techniques, efficient insulation, and natural ventilation can minimise the need for constant heating and cooling. Smart design not only enhances comfort but also reduces the energy burden on buildings.

Promote Sustainable Transportation - the transportation sector is a major contributor to energy demand. Embracing sustainable transportation options such as electric vehicles, public transit, cycling, and walking can significantly reduce the reliance on fossil fuels. Carpooling and ridesharing initiatives also contribute to a more efficient use of energy resources.

Encourage Telecommuting and Flexible Work Arrangements - the shift towards remote work and flexible schedules has gained momentum in recent years. Beyond the benefits of increased work-life balance, remote work reduces the need for daily commutes, lowering energy demand associated with transportation and office space.

Optimize Industrial Processes - industries are significant consumers of energy, and optimising manufacturing processes can lead to substantial reductions in energy demand. Implementing energy-efficient technologies, recycling waste heat, and adopting sustainable production practices contribute to a more responsible and resource-conscious industrial sector.

Educate and Raise Awareness - public awareness and education are crucial in fostering a culture of energy consciousness. Governments, NGOs, and communities can collaborate to educate individuals about the impact of their energy choices. Initiatives such as energy conservation campaigns, workshops, and educational programs can empower people to make informed decisions.

Incentivise Energy Conservation - governments and businesses can play a pivotal role in reducing energy demand by offering incentives for energy conservation. This may include tax credits, subsidies for energy-efficient technologies, and rewards for businesses that adopt sustainable practices. Financial incentives create a tangible motivation for individuals and organisations to invest in energy-efficient solutions.

Implement Time-of-Use Pricing - time-of-use pricing structures can encourage consumers to shift their energy usage to off-peak hours when demand is lower. This not only helps balance the load on the energy grid but also reduces the need for additional infrastructure to meet peak demand.

Explore Alternative Energy Sources - investing in renewable energy sources, such as solar, wind, and hydropower, can diversify the energy mix and reduce dependence on non-renewable resources. Governments and businesses can support the development and implementation of alternative energy solutions to meet growing demands sustainably.
